Ingredients:
- 4 salmon fillets, about 6 ounces each
- 4 cloves of gar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ons of fresh parsley, finely chopped
- 2 tablespoons of fresh dill, finely chopped
- 2 tablespoons of unsalted butter
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Lemon wedges, for serving
Instructions:
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- In a small bowl, mix the minced garlic, chopped parsley, chopped dill, salt, and pepper.
- Melt the butter in a small saucepan over medium heat, remove it from the heat, and stir in the garlic and herb mixture.
- Place the salmon fillets in a baking dish, skin-side down.
- Pour the garlic and herb butter over the salmon fillets, spreading it evenly.
- Bake the salmon in the oven for 12-15 minutes or until it’s cooked through.
- Remove the salmon from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before serving.
- Serve the salmon hot, garnished with lemon wedges.
